Дорога в будущее - Билл Гейтс
Шрифт:
Интервал:
Закладка:
Независимо от того, как Вы подаете команды: голосом, записывая их от руки или указывая в меню, выбор будет пошире элементарного переключения между программами, и, естественно, Вам захочется, чтобы это делалось просто. Вряд ли кому-то понравится слишком запутанное управление, которое заставляет попусту терять время. Программная платформа магистрали должна настолько упростить поиск информации, чтобы ее смог найти даже тот, кто сам не знает, чего ему надо. А информации будет целое море. Ведь магистраль обеспечит доступ ко всему: товарам, услугам, сокровищам сотен библиотек... перечислять можно еще долго.
Опасения, которые вызывает магистраль, чаще всего касаются «перегрузки информацией». Обычно их слышишь от тех, чье чересчур развитое воображение рисует такую картину: по волоконно-оптическим кабелям магистрали, как из рога изобилия, так и сыпятся на бедную голову громадные порции всевозможных сведений.
Перегрузка информацией – явление достаточно распространенное и не должно быть проблемой. Мы уже давно умеем справляться с огромными массивами сведений, опираясь на обширную инфраструктуру, помогающую отбирать только самое нужное, – от библиотечных каталогов и обзоров видеофильмов до «Желтых страниц» и советов знакомых. Если кто-то беспокоится по поводу перегрузки информацией, спросите его, как он подбирает себе книги. Ведь заходя в книжный магазин или библиотеку, никто не собирается читать все подряд. По каталогам, указателям и книжным обозрениям каждый отбирает нужное.
Сплав технологий и искусства аннотирования, заложенный в информационную магистраль, поможет находить материал самыми разными способами. Идеальная система навигации должна быть мощной и в то же время простой в использовании. Базовыми методами выборки требуемых сведений будут запросы (queries), фильтры (filters), пространственная навигация (spatial navigation), гиперсвязи (hyperlinks) и агенты (agents).
Суть различных методов выборки информации легче всего понять через образные сравнения. Представьте, что в некое хранилище помещен набор специфических сведений – перечень каких-то фактов, список фильмов или что-то еще. Запрос приводит к перебору всех элементов в хранилище и проверке каждого из них на соответствие заданному критерию. Фильтр действует иначе: он постоянно проверяет на соответствие заданному критерию новые поступления. Пространственная навигация: Вы бродите по хранилищу и заглядываете на полки только в определенных местах.
Но, по-видимому, самый целесообразный и, пожалуй, самый простой подход по сравнению с остальными – заручиться помощью частного агента, представляющего Вас на информационной магистрали. В действительности агент будет программой, в которую заложена некая личность; тем или иным способом Вы сможете общаться с этой личностью. Похоже на то, как будто вместо себя Вы отправляете на поиски своего помощника.
Вот как работают разные системы. Запрос, по сути, тот же вопрос, на который Вы получаете исчерпывающий ответ. Например, Вы не помните название фильма, но знаете, что в нем сыграли Спенсер Треси (Spencer Тrаcy) и Кэтрин Хепберн (Katharine Hepburn) и что там есть сцена, где он засыпает вопросами дрожащую от холода героиню. Итак, введите запрос на все киноленты, в которых есть «Спенсер Треси», «Кэтрин Хепберн», «холод» и «вопросы». В ответ сервер сообщит о романтической комедии 1957 года Desk Set (Кабинетный гарнитур), в которой Треси в самый разгар зимы на террасе, на крыше небоскреба, допытывается о чем-то у окоченевшей Хепберн. Вы сможете просмотреть эту сцену или весь фильм целиком, прочесть сценарий, изучить реакцию критиков и узнать комментарии, когда-либо прозвучавшие из уст Треси и Хепберн по поводу этой сцены. Если картина продублирована или снабжена субтитрами для зарубежного проката, Вы сможете познакомиться и с такими ее версиями. Хранимые, скорее всего, на серверах в разных странах, они в мгновение ока окажутся в Вашем распоряжении.
Система воспримет не только прямолинейные запросы типа «Покажи все опубликованные в мире статьи о первом младенце из пробирки», «Дай список всех магазинов, которые предлагают не менее двух сортов собачьего корма и которые могут доставить заказ не позднее чем через час» или «Кому из своих родственников я не звонил уже больше трех месяцев?». Она справится и с более сложными запросами, например: «В каком крупном городе самая высокая доля тех, кто смотрит видеоклипы рок-музыкантов и регулярно интересуется международной торговлей?» В общем случае подобные вопросы не потребуют длительного ожидания, поскольку многие из них с большой степенью вероятности уже были кем-то заданы и ответы на них подготовлены и хранятся в готовом виде.
Кроме того, Вы сможете также устанавливать «фильтры» – своего рода постоянно действующие запросы. Они будут круглосуточно отслеживать новую информацию, соответствующую Вашим интересам, и отфильтровывать все постороннее. Запрограммированный фильтр станет собирать только определенные сведения, скажем новости о местной спортивной команде или достижения в конкретной области наук. Если для Вас нет ничего важнее прогноза погоды, фильтр вынесет его на первую полосу Вашей «персональной газеты». Некоторые фильтры будут создаваться Вашим компьютером автоматически – просто потому, что ему «известны» Ваше образование, деловые связи, окружение и основной круг интересов. Мне, например, такой фильтр мог бы сообщить о чем-то важном, касающемся моего прошлого: «Метеорит вдребезги разнес Lakeside School». Разумеется, Вы вправе и сами создать фильтры, скажем, постоянно действующий запрос типа «Требуется: Nissan Maxima 1990 года на запчасти», «Сообщить о любом, кто продает сувениры с прошлого Кубка мира по футболу» или «Ищу напарника – велосипедного фаната для воскресных моционов и в дождь, и в жару». Фильтр будет «начеку» до тех пор, пока Вы не прекратите его действие. Однако и это еще не все. Найдя Вам, допустим, напарника для воскресной езды на велосипеде, фильтр автоматически проверит и другие сведения, которые тот мог обнародовать в сети. Фильтр попытается выяснить: «Что он собой представляет?» – ведь это первое, что бы Вы сами спросили о своем новом друге.
Пространственная навигация будет базироваться на принципе, по которому мы находим информацию сегодня. Желая подыскать что-то на ту или иную тему, Вы идете в соответствующий отдел библиотеки или книжного магазина. Примерно то же самое практикуется и в газетах; в них есть разделы: спорт, недвижимость, бизнес, сообщения о погоде и т.д. Все эти рубрики в большинстве газет изо дня в день появляются строго на своем месте.
Пространственная навигация, которая уже применяется в некоторых программных продуктах, позволяет быстро переходить туда, где находится информация на нужную тему; при этом Вы взаимодействуете с механизмом поиска через визуальную модель реального или придуманного (виртуального) мира. Такую модель можно представить как карту или как иллюстрированное трехмерное оглавление. Пространственная навигация сыграет особенно важную роль при управлении телевизором и крохотным персональным компьютером, у которых вряд ли будет обычная клавиатура.